Just as they achieved full health, the Detroit Red Wings are likely to be without one, maybe two regulars. Forward Lucas Raymond limped off the practice facility inside Little Caesars Arena on Friday after colliding with teammate Ben Chiarot. Coach Derek Lalonde described Raymond as “in the day-to-day range,” and didn’t have much further information

Detroit − Filip Zadina picked a pretty good time to get his first goal of the season. Playing in his first game since November, after suffering a lower-body injury, Zadina’s third-period goal lifted the Red Wings to a 2-1 victory Thursday over Calgary.
